Hi there - our six year old thoroughbred gelding hs injured his knees after attempting to jump a wire fence into a paddock. He landed on his knees but has not damaged any skin - all skin covering the caps is sound however both knees are hugely swollen. This happened two days ago. We have been hosing three times a day, using ice poultices and now have bandaged both legs. He is in a paddock with two other horses and we have not attempted to confine him as we are concerned he will become very stressed with the separation and possibly incur more damage. Have also been using anti inflammatories and while they seem to help with pain management are not have reducing the swelling. As it is xmas very hard to get hold of a vet here. Any suggestions to help guide us through this gretly appreciated. Also if any one has an estimate as to how long the swelling should take to go down would be greatly appreciated.
